Review:
Based on the hymn tune NICAEA, this big, bold, and bright arrangement was written for the celebration of the 20th anniversary of the Kokomo Handbell Festival in Indiana. Bells, organ, and timpani trade flourishes and grand statements of praise throughout the work, with handbells ringing a solo section 2/3 of the way in it. This fanfare-style piece is set in C Major and is 109 measures.
